About Sharesa
Sharesa is a lovely name with a captivating blend of meanings. It's a feminine name of African-American origin, a unique combination of the names Share and Lisa. The component "Share," deriving from the English verb "to share," embodies generosity and community. Meanwhile, Lisa contributes a spiritual element, meaning "pledged to God" or "devoted to God." Therefore, the name Sharesa beautifully combines the concepts of sharing and devotion.
Though not widely known, its relatively uncommon usage gives Sharesa an air of exclusivity. This makes it a truly unique choice for parents seeking a distinctive name. While occasionally experiencing minor surges in popularity, it hasn't achieved widespread fame. Its origins and meaning remain somewhat mysterious, adding to its appeal. The name is sometimes spelled Sharisa, though Sharesa remains the primary spelling.
